• Bit 7:0 - JTAGUID[7:0]: JTAG User ID
The JTAGUID can be used to identify two devices with identical Device ID in a JTAG scan chain.
The JTAGUID will during reset automatically be loaded from flash and placed in these registers.
• Bit 7:1 - Reserved
These bits are unused and reserved for future use. For compatibility with future devices, always
write these bits to zero when this register is written.
• Bit 0 - JTAGD: JTAG Disable
Setting this bit will disable the JTAG interface. This bit is protected by the Configuration Change
Protection mechanism, for details refer to
page
• Bit 7:5 - Reserved
These bits are reserved and will always be read as zero. For compatibility with future devices,
always write these bits to zero when this register is written.
• Bit 4 - EVSYS1LOCK:
Setting this bit will lock all registers in the Event System related to event channels 4 to 7 for fur-
ther modifications. The following registers in the Event System are locked: CH4MUX,
CH4CTRL, CH5MUX, CH5CTRL, CH6MUX, CH6CTRL, CH7MUX, CH7CTRL. This bit is pro-
tected by the Configuration Change Protection mechanism, for details refer to
”Configuration Change Protection” on page
• Bit 3:1 - Reserved
These bits are reserved and will always be read as zero. For compatibility with future devices,
always write these bits to zero when this register is written.
• Bit 0 - EVSYS0LOCK:
Setting this bit will lock all registers in the Event System related to event channels 0 to 3 for fur-
ther modifications. The following registers in the Event System are locked: CH0MUX,
CH0CTRL, CH1MUX, CH1CTRL, CH2MUX, CH2CTRL, CH3MUX, CH3CTRL. This bit is pro-
